Press freedom, civil liberties go together: Sanjrani

ISLAMABAD, May 03 (APP):Senate Chairman Muhammad Sadiq Sanjrani while felicitating the journalist community on the eve of World Press Freedom Day on Friday said media was an important pillar of the state.
He said that the press gallery in the Parliament reminded of the transparency and accountability by the public. The media workers were executing their duties while endangering their lives and many of them were working in an insecure environment.
“At the time, when we are paying a rich tribute to the services of media professionals, I will ask the government to play its role for resolving the issues of payment of their dues and protection of their jobs.”
Sanjrani while presiding over the Senate session remarked that journalists had their hands on the pulse of the society. “They can mould the society towards any behaviour they intend to through the medium of mass communication. A free press can therefore be a guarantor of a flourishing society,” he added.
The Senate chairman underscored the need to look inwards on this day and strive to fill in the existing gaps. May 3 which was proclaimed as World Press Freedom Day by the United Nations General Assembly in 1993 celebrates the fundamental principles of press freedom, to evaluate press freedom around the world, to defend the media from attacks on their independence and to pay glowing tribute to journalists who have lost their lives while discharging their duties.
Sanjrani observed that Pakistan had come a long way when it came to struggles for press freedom and independence.
